1. The Hidden Role of Drapes and Blinds

Every day, air circulates through your home — carrying dust, pollen, pet dander, and microscopic pollutants. Drapes and blinds catch these particles, acting as passive air filters.

Over time, that means:

  • Layers of dust settle deep into fabric folds and pleats.

  • Blinds collect grease, smoke, and residue, especially in kitchens.

  • Allergens linger in fibers long after they enter through open windows.

This buildup doesn’t just dull the look of your window coverings — it also affects your indoor environment. When heating or cooling systems run, they stir up this trapped dust, releasing it back into the air you breathe.


2. Why Indoor Air Quality Matters

According to environmental health experts, indoor air can be two to five times more polluted than outdoor air — particularly in colder climates like Ottawa’s, where homes stay closed for months at a time.

Common indoor pollutants include:

  • Dust and dander.

  • Mold spores from humidity or condensation.

  • Smoke and cooking particles.

  • Chemicals from cleaning products or building materials.

When these pollutants accumulate on fabrics like drapes and upholstery, they continue to circulate throughout your home. Clean window coverings play a vital role in reducing that cycle and keeping the air fresh.


3. Ottawa’s Climate Makes Cleaning Even More Important

Ottawa homeowners face unique air quality challenges. Between long winters, dry indoor air, and frequent use of heating systems, your drapes and blinds become magnets for dust and residue.

In winter months:

  • Windows stay closed, trapping stale air inside.

  • Static electricity causes dust to cling to fabrics.

  • Heating vents circulate fine particles throughout the home.

Add spring pollen or summer humidity, and your window coverings become prime real estate for allergens and grime. Professional drapery and blind cleaning helps maintain a cleaner, healthier home environment no matter the season.


4. The Health Benefits of Clean Drapes and Blinds

Clean window coverings do more than brighten your décor — they can improve your health and well-being.

a) Reduced Allergens

Dust mites, pollen, and pet dander trapped in fabrics are common triggers for sneezing, congestion, and itchy eyes. Regular cleaning removes these irritants, helping everyone breathe easier.

b) Improved Air Quality

By removing particles that would otherwise re-circulate in the air, professional cleaning improves indoor freshness and reduces the strain on HVAC systems.

c) Mold and Mildew Prevention

In damp conditions, condensation on windows can transfer moisture to fabrics. Deep cleaning and proper drying prevent mold growth and musty odours.

d) Odour Elimination

Cooking, smoking, or pet smells cling to drapes and blinds over time. Cleaning neutralizes odours, leaving your home smelling naturally clean instead of masked with air fresheners.


5. How Professional Drapery & Blind Cleaning Works

Professional cleaning goes far beyond a quick dusting or vacuum. The process is designed to safely and effectively restore your window coverings without shrinkage, color fading, or damage.

Step 1: Inspection

Technicians assess fabric type, age, and condition to determine the best cleaning approach.

Step 2: Pre-Treatment

Dust and surface debris are removed using gentle vacuuming or air movement.

Step 3: Cleaning

Depending on material and soil level, methods may include:

  • Steam cleaning: Ideal for deep sanitization and odour removal.

  • Dry cleaning: Perfect for delicate or lined fabrics.

  • Ultrasonic cleaning: Used for blinds to lift away grime from every slat.

Step 4: Drying and Reinstallation

Drapes and blinds are dried completely to prevent shrinkage and mildew, then carefully reinstalled to their exact fit.

6. How Often Should You Clean Drapes and Blinds?

Frequency depends on lifestyle, home environment, and exposure. As a general guideline:

  • Every 12–18 months: For average Ottawa homes.

  • Every 6–12 months: For homes with pets, smokers, or allergies.

  • Every 2–3 years: For less-used formal areas.

Spring and fall are ideal times to schedule professional cleaning — before heavy heating or cooling cycles spread accumulated dust through the house.


7. DIY Maintenance Between Professional Cleanings

Keeping up with light maintenance between professional cleanings extends the life and freshness of your drapes and blinds.

Simple home care tips:

  • Dust weekly: Use a vacuum brush or microfiber cloth on blinds and fabric folds.

  • Shake out drapes gently: Especially near vents or windows.

  • Spot clean carefully: Use mild soap and water on small stains — avoid harsh chemicals.

  • Ventilate regularly: Open windows briefly during dry days to refresh the air.

  • Check for moisture: Wipe window condensation to prevent mold.

These small habits keep your fabrics cleaner for longer and reduce buildup between deep cleans.


8. Signs It’s Time for a Professional Cleaning

You may not notice gradual buildup, but your window coverings will show signs when it’s time for attention:

  • Faded or discolored fabric.

  • Musty or stale odours near windows.

  • Visible dust when sunlight shines through.

  • Increased allergy or respiratory symptoms indoors.

  • Blinds that feel sticky or grimy to the touch.

9. The Impact on Home Décor and Longevity

Clean drapes and blinds not only make your home healthier — they make it look better. Fabrics regain their color, texture, and drape. Metal or wood blinds shine again, adding to your home’s overall brightness.

More importantly, regular maintenance extends the lifespan of your investment. Dust and debris can act like sandpaper, wearing down fibers and finishes over time. Professional cleaning preserves quality and saves you from premature replacements.
